Web1 Corinthians 7 1. He discusses marriage; 4. showing it to be a remedy against sinful desires, 10. and that the bond thereof ought not lightly to be dissolved. 20. Every man must be content with his vocation. 25. Virginity wherefore to be embraced; 35. and for what respects we may either marry, or abstain from marrying. To the rest I say this (I, not the Lord): If any brother has a wife who is not a believer and she is willing to live with him, he must not divorce her. And if a woman has a husband who is not a believer and he is willing to live with her, she must not divorce him.
